At Google I/O, Sergey Brin makes shock look — and declares Google will construct the primary AGI


Be part of our every day and weekly newsletters for the most recent updates and unique content material on industry-leading AI protection. Study Extra


At Google I/O this week, amid the standard parade of dazzling product demos and AI-powered bulletins, one thing uncommon occurred: Google declared warfare — quietly — within the race to construct synthetic basic intelligence (AGI).

“We totally intend that Gemini would be the very first AGI,” stated Google co-founder Sergey Brin, who made a shock, unscheduled look at what was initially deliberate as a solo fireplace chat with Demis Hassabis, CEO of DeepMind, Google’s AI analysis powerhouse. The dialog, hosted by Large Expertise founder Alex Kantrowitz, pressed each males on the way forward for intelligence, scale, and the evolving definition of what it means for a machine to suppose.

The second was fleeting, however unmistakable. In a area the place most gamers hedge their discuss of AGI with caveats — or keep away from the time period altogether — Brin’s remark stood out. It marked the primary time a Google govt has explicitly said an intent to win the AGI race, a contest usually related extra with Silicon Valley rivals like OpenAI and Elon Musk than with the search big.

But Brin’s boldness contrasted sharply with the warning expressed by Hassabis, a former neuroscientist and recreation developer whose imaginative and prescient has lengthy steered DeepMind’s strategy to AI. Whereas Brin framed AGI as an imminent milestone and aggressive goal, Hassabis known as for readability, restraint, and scientific precision.

“What I’m inquisitive about, and what I might name AGI, is known as a extra theoretical assemble, which is, what’s the human mind as an structure in a position to do?” Hassabis defined. “It’s clear to me at the moment, methods don’t have that. After which the opposite factor that why I believe it’s form of overblown the hype at the moment on AGI is that our methods are usually not constant sufficient to be thought of to be totally Common. But they’re fairly basic.”

This philosophical pressure between Brin and Hassabis — one chasing scale and first-mover benefit, the opposite warning of overreach — might outline Google’s future as a lot as any product launch.

Inside Google’s AGI timeline: Why Brin and Hassabis disagree on when superintelligence will arrive

The distinction between the 2 executives turned much more obvious when Kantrowitz posed a easy query: AGI earlier than or after 2030?

“Earlier than,” Brin answered with out hesitation.

“Simply after,” Hassabis countered with a smile, prompting Brin to joke that Hassabis was “sandbagging.”

This five-second alternate encapsulates the refined however important pressure in Google’s AGI technique. Whereas each males clearly imagine highly effective AI methods are coming this decade, their completely different timelines replicate essentially completely different approaches to the know-how’s growth.

Hassabis took pains all through the dialog to ascertain a extra rigorous definition of AGI than is often utilized in {industry} discussions. For him, the human mind serves as “an essential reference level, as a result of it’s the one proof we now have, possibly within the universe, that basic intelligence is feasible.”

True AGI, in his view, would require exhibiting “your system was able to doing the vary of issues even one of the best people in historical past had been in a position to do with the identical mind structure. It’s not one mind however the identical mind structure. So what Einstein did, what Mozart was in a position to do, what Marie Curie and so forth.”

In contrast, Brin’s focus appeared extra oriented towards aggressive positioning than scientific precision. When requested about his return to day-to-day technical work at Google, Brin defined: “As a pc scientist, it’s a really distinctive time in historical past, like, truthfully, anyone who’s a pc scientist shouldn’t be retired proper now. Ought to be engaged on AI.”

DeepMind’s scientific roadmap clashes with Google’s aggressive AGI technique

Regardless of their completely different emphases, each leaders outlined comparable technical challenges that should be solved on the trail to extra superior AI.

Hassabis recognized a number of particular obstacles, noting that “to get all the way in which to one thing like AGI, I believe might require one or two extra new breakthroughs.” He pointed to limitations in present methods’ reasoning skills, artistic invention, and the accuracy of their “world fashions.”

“For me, for one thing to be known as AGI, it might should be constant, far more constant throughout the board than it’s at the moment,” Hassabis defined. “It ought to take, like, a few months for possibly a group of specialists to discover a gap in it, an apparent gap in it, whereas at the moment, it takes a person minutes to seek out that.”

Each executives agreed on the significance of “considering” capabilities in AI methods. Google’s newly introduced “deep suppose” function, which permits AI fashions to have interaction in parallel reasoning processes that verify one another, represents a step on this course.

“We’ve all the time been huge believers in what we’re now calling this considering paradigm,” Hassabis stated, referencing DeepMind’s early work on methods like AlphaGo. “When you take a look at a recreation like chess or go… we had variations of AlphaGo and AlphaZero with the considering turned off. So it was simply the mannequin telling you its first thought. And, you understand, it’s not dangerous. It’s possibly like grasp degree… However then in case you flip the considering on, it’s been means past World Champion degree.”

Brin concurred, including: “Most of us, we get some profit by considering earlier than we converse. And though not all the time, I used to be reminded to try this, however I believe that the AIs clearly, are a lot stronger when you add that functionality.”

Past scale: How Google is betting on algorithmic breakthroughs to win the AGI race

When pressed on whether or not scaling present fashions or creating new algorithmic approaches would drive progress, each leaders emphasised the necessity for each — although with barely completely different emphases.

“I’ve all the time been of the opinion you want each,” Hassabis stated. “That you must scale to the utmost the strategies that you understand about. You need to exploit them to the restrict, whether or not that’s information or compute, scale, and on the identical time, you need to spend a bunch of effort on what’s coming subsequent.”

Brin agreed however added a notable historic perspective: “When you take a look at issues just like the N-body downside and simulating simply gravitational our bodies… as you plot it, the algorithmic advances have truly overwhelmed out the computational advances, even with Moore’s regulation. If I needed to guess, I might say the algorithmic advances are most likely going to be much more important than the computational advances.”

This emphasis on algorithmic innovation over pure computational scale aligns with Google’s latest analysis focus, together with the Alpha-Evolve system introduced final week that makes use of AI to enhance AI algorithms.

Google’s multimodal imaginative and prescient: Why camera-first AI provides Gemini a strategic benefit

An space of clear alignment between the 2 executives was the significance of AI methods that may course of and generate a number of modalities — notably visible info.

In contrast to opponents whose AI demos usually emphasize voice assistants or text-based interactions, Google’s imaginative and prescient for AI closely incorporates cameras and visible processing. This was evident within the firm’s announcement of latest good glasses and the emphasis on laptop imaginative and prescient all through its I/O shows.

“Gemini was constructed from the start, even the earliest variations, to be multimodal,” Hassabis defined. “That made it tougher in the beginning… however ultimately, I believe we’re reaping the advantages of these choices now.”

Hassabis recognized two key functions for vision-capable AI: “a very helpful assistant that may come round with you in your every day life, not simply caught in your laptop or one system,” and robotics, the place he believes the bottleneck has all the time been the “software program intelligence” reasonably than {hardware}.

“I’ve all the time felt that the common assistant is the killer app for good glasses,” Hassabis added, a press release that positions Google’s newly introduced system as central to its AI technique.

Navigating AI security: How Google plans to construct AGI with out breaking the web

Each executives acknowledged the dangers that include speedy AI growth, notably with generative capabilities.

When requested about video era and the potential for mannequin degradation from coaching on AI-generated content material — a phenomenon some researchers name “mannequin collapse” — Hassabis outlined Google’s strategy to accountable growth.

“We’re very rigorous with our information high quality administration and curation,” he stated. “For all of our generative fashions, we connect SynthID to them, so there’s this invisible AI-made watermark that’s fairly, very sturdy, has held up now for a 12 months, 18 months since we launched it.”

The priority about accountable growth extends to AGI itself. When requested whether or not one firm would dominate the panorama, Hassabis instructed that after the primary methods are constructed, “we are able to think about utilizing them to shard off many methods which have protected architectures, form of constructed below… provably beneath them.”

From simulation idea to AGI: The philosophical divide between Google’s AI leaders

Maybe probably the most revealing second got here on the finish of the dialog, when Kantrowitz requested a lighthearted query about whether or not we stay in a simulation — impressed by a cryptic tweet from Hassabis.

Even right here, the philosophical variations between the 2 executives had been obvious. Hassabis supplied a nuanced perspective: “I don’t suppose that is some sort of recreation, though I wrote loads of video games. I do suppose that in the end, underlying physics is info idea. So I do suppose we’re in a computational universe, but it surely’s not only a simple simulation.”

Brin, in the meantime, approached the query with logical precision: “If we’re in a simulation, then by the identical argument, no matter beings are making the simulation are themselves in a simulation for roughly the identical causes, and so forth so forth. So I believe you’re going to need to both settle for that we’re in an infinite stack of simulations or that there’s bought to be some stopping standards.”

The alternate captured the important dynamic between the 2: Hassabis the philosopher-scientist, approaching questions with nuance and from first ideas; Brin the pragmatic engineer, breaking issues down into logical parts.

Brin’s declaration throughout his Google I/O look marks a seismic shift within the AGI race. By explicitly stating Google’s intent to win, he’s deserted the corporate’s earlier restraint and straight challenged OpenAI’s place because the perceived AGI frontrunner.

That is no small matter. For years, OpenAI has owned the AGI narrative whereas Google rigorously prevented such daring proclamations. Sam Altman has relentlessly positioned OpenAI’s complete existence round the pursuit of synthetic basic intelligence, turning what was as soon as an esoteric technical idea into each a company mission and cultural touchstone. His frequent hints about GPT-5’s capabilities and imprecise however tantalizing feedback about synthetic superintelligence have saved OpenAI in headlines and investor decks.

By deploying Brin — not simply any govt, however a founder with near-mythic standing in Silicon Valley — Google has successfully introduced it received’t cede this territory and not using a struggle. The transfer carries particular weight coming from Brin, who not often makes public appearances however instructions extraordinary respect amongst engineers and traders alike.

The timing couldn’t be extra important. With Microsoft’s backing giving OpenAI seemingly limitless assets, and Meta’s aggressive open-source technique threatening to commoditize sure points of AI growth, Google wanted to reassert its place on the vanguard of AI analysis. Brin’s assertion does precisely that, serving as each a rallying cry for Google’s AI expertise and a shot throughout the bow to opponents.

What makes this three-way contest notably fascinating is how in a different way every firm approaches the AGI problem. OpenAI has guess on tight secrecy round coaching strategies paired with splashy shopper merchandise. Meta emphasizes open analysis and democratized entry. Google, with this new positioning, seems to be staking out center floor: the scientific rigor of DeepMind mixed with the aggressive urgency embodied by Brin’s return.

What Google’s AGI gambit means for the way forward for AI innovation

As Google continues its push towards extra highly effective AI methods, the steadiness between these approaches will probably decide its success in what has develop into an more and more aggressive area.

Google’s resolution to deliver Brin again into day-to-day operations whereas sustaining Hassabis’s management at DeepMind suggests an understanding that each aggressive drive and scientific rigor are obligatory parts of its AI technique.

Whether or not Gemini will certainly develop into “the very first AGI,” as Brin confidently predicted, stays to be seen. However the dialog at I/O made clear that Google is now overtly competing in a race it had beforehand approached with extra warning.

For an {industry} watching each sign from AI’s main gamers, Brin’s declaration represents a big shift in tone — one that will strain opponents to speed up their very own timelines, whilst voices like Hassabis proceed to advocate for cautious definitions and accountable growth.

On this pressure between pace and science, Google might have discovered its distinctive place within the AGI race: formidable sufficient to compete, cautious sufficient to do it proper.
